    I purchased and then returned this all in the same day. My return had nothing to do with the GARMIN. Over the years they have changed the screens. My old one has a matte screen that reduces glare. This is very important for me since I use the GARMIN in a convertible. The sunlight hitting the screen made it unusable. Had my second vehicle not had a navigation system, I would have kept it for that vehicle. It has everything you need in a navigation system and then some. A big screen, efficient routing, and the ability to set numerous parameters. Had this had a matte screen I would have it now.

    About 8 or more years ago I purchased a Garmin Nuvi 65. I still have it and it still works. So in the last year I have been trying to replace it with a newer and faster one. Also a bigger screen would have been nice. The first Garmin I replaced it with was beautiful. The glass screen made the color and detail just jump out at you, until the sun hit it. This was to be used exclusively in a convertible . . . in Texas. So that was all the time. I took it back before the day was over. About a month later I decided to try another one. Again the same problem. It too went back. I had just about given up and decided that my old Garmin would have to do. Then I was reading a review about the 2597 and one of the cons was that it was not as bright and clear because it DID NOT have a glass screen. I decided to give it a try. I write this about 2 months after purchasing it and still have it and plan on keeping it. It does not wash out in the convertible with the top down. It loads quickly. The voice recognition is not perfect, but typing on the screen is so much easier than my old Garmin. I would say that it works about 50/50. It does seem to be getting better. Maybe I am learning to speaker more clearly. It is filled with all of the latest info. Here are a few that I like: posted speed limit and my speed are displayed on the big 5 inch screen, school zone alert, displays coming streets, easier to take out of the cradle. There are no negative comments. The things I do not like, I turn off. I am happy to have a new state of the art navigation system that I can see in my convertible with top down. The icing on the cake is that I extracted the British Kate voice from my old Garmin and installed it on this one.
